Walk through any newly renovated kitchen and you will see the obvious investments. Granite countertops, custom cabinetry, high-end appliances. The homeowner points to the waterfall island and the smart refrigerator. No one mentions the hinge. That same hinge will open and close that beautiful cabinet door twenty times a day, every day, for ten years. A cheap hinge starts to sag within two years. The door rubs, the paint chips, and suddenly the thousand-dollar cabinet looks shabby. This is not a hypothetical. The National Association of Home Builders reports that cabinet hardware is among the most frequently replaced components in kitchens, often before the cabinets themselves wear out. The problem is not just aesthetics. It is money and waste.

The hidden cost of cheap hardware
Consider this data: the average American home has about 40 hinges on interior doors alone. Add cabinet hinges, drawer slides, and latches, and the number jumps above 100. If each piece of cheap hardware fails within five years, the replacement cost for parts alone runs into hundreds of dollars. But the real cost is labor. Installing a door hinge requires a drill, screws, and about fifteen minutes. Replacing one that has stripped its screw holes means patching the frame, repainting, and then hanging the door again. A three-dollar hinge that fails five times over a thirty-year mortgage can actually cost more than a ten-dollar hinge that never fails. Builders know this. That is why commercial contractors buy from suppliers who sell hardware by the pallet, not by the blister pack. Residential homeowners get the cheap stuff because the builder wants to hit a price point, not a durability target.
The numbers back this up. A study by the Building Science Corporation found that the average builder saves about 12 cents per hinge by using the lowest-grade product. Over a 2,000-square-foot house, that works out to a savings of roughly $48. But the homeowner will spend $400 over the next decade replacing those same hinges. The cheap hardware does not save money at all. It just transfers the cost to the occupant.
How material science changed small parts
Twenty years ago, a good hinge was made from solid brass or steel. Those materials still work, but the industry has moved. Modern hardware uses zinc alloys with anti-corrosion coatings. Some premium products use cold-rolled steel with a nickel finish that withstands salt spray tests for over 200 hours. The difference matters in coastal climates. In Florida, hardware that rusts within a year is common. In dry desert environments, cheap plastic bushings crack from thermal expansion. The smartest builders now match hardware to the climate zone. They use marine-grade stainless in humid areas and powder-coated steel in cold ones.
The cost of these advanced materials has dropped. A soft-close drawer slide that cost $25 in 2010 now sells for $12. But that price depends on the exact grade of the bearings. A cheap slide uses plastic rollers that wear flat after 5,000 cycles. A quality slide uses steel ball bearings rated for 100,000 cycles. The difference is invisible in a showroom. It reveals itself only after years of use. Matching hardware to your environment
Every house has its own microclimate. A kitchen next to the stove gets heat, steam, and grease. A bathroom gets constant humidity. An exterior door faces rain, sun, and wind. One hinge specification does not fit all these places. Yet most builders install identical hardware throughout the house. The same hinge that works fine in a bedroom will fail in a bathroom within two years because the plating is not thick enough to resist moisture. The standard in the hardware industry is ASTM B456 for corrosion resistance. A good hinge meets at least a Grade 2 classification. Many cheap hinges do not meet any standard. They lack the coating thickness to pass even a basic salt spray test.
Look at the screw as well. Almost all hardware comes with screws. Those screws are often made from the same low-grade steel as the hinge. They strip when you tighten them with a power driver. A quality manufacturer supplies hardened steel screws with a Phillips or square drive head that bites into the wood without caming out.
